The Artificial General Intelligence (AGI) team is looking for a passionate, talented, and inventive Principal Applied Scientist with a strong deep learning background, to lead the development of industry-leading technology with multimodal systems.

As a Principal Applied Scientist, you are a trusted part of the technical leadership. You bring business and industry context to science and technology decisions. You set the standard for scientific excellence and make decisions that affect the way we build and integrate algorithms. You solicit differing views across the organization and are willing to change your mind as you learn more. Your artifacts are exemplary and often used as reference across the organization.
You are a hands-on scientific leader. Your solutions are exemplary in terms of algorithm design, clarity, model structure, efficiency, and extensibility. You tackle intrinsically hard problems, acquiring expertise as needed. You decompose complex problems into straightforward solutions.
You amplify your impact by leading scientific reviews within your organization or at your location. You scrutinize and review experimental design, modeling, verification, and other research procedures. You probe assumptions, illuminate pitfalls, and foster shared understanding. You align teams toward coherent strategies. You educate, keeping the scientific community up to date on advanced techniques, state of the art approaches, the latest technologies, and trends. You help managers guide the career growth of other scientists by mentoring and play a significant role in hiring and developing scientists and leads.

Key job responsibilities:
You will be responsible for defining key research directions, adopting or inventing new machine learning techniques, conducting rigorous experiments, publishing results, and ensuring that research is translated into practice. You will develop long-term strategies, persuade teams to adopt those strategies, propose goals and deliver on them. You will also participate in organizational planning, hiring, mentorship, and leadership development. You will be technically fearless and have a passion for building scalable science and engineering solutions. You will serve as a key scientific resource in full-cycle development (conception, design, implementation, testing to documentation, delivery, and maintenance).

BASIC QUALIFICATIONS

PhD with specialization in artificial intelligence, natural language processing, machine learning, or computational cognitive science; 10+ years of combined academic and research experience. Strong publication record in top-tier journals and conferences. Functional thought leader, sought after for key tech decisions. Can successfully sell ideas to an executive level decision maker. Mentors and trains the research scientist community on complex technical issues. Experience developing software in traditional programming languages (C++, Java, etc.). Excellent written and spoken communication skills.

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S

Strong software development skills. Experience working effectively with science, data processing, and software engineering teams. Proven track record of innovation in creating novel algorithms and advancing the state of the art. Entrepreneurial spirit combined with strong architectural and problem-solving skills.
